Connect to your opportunity

As an Assistant Data Quality Manager, you will play a critical role in supporting the design, implementation, and operationalisation of the firms data quality framework. You will work closely with Data Quality Managers, Data Owners, Data Stewards, and technology teams to ensure data is accurate, complete, consistent, and fit for purpose, underpinning reporting, regulatory compliance, and AI-driven initiatives.

You will be instrumental in building and maintaining trust in our data, which is foundational to Deloitte's ability to deliver high-quality services and insights to our clients and internal stakeholders. This is an exciting opportunity to contribute to the strategic evolution of data management in a leading professional services firm, shaping how data is perceived and utilised across the organisation.

Key Responsibilities:

Data Profiling and Analysis:

  • Conduct comprehensive data profiling across diverse datasets to identify characteristics, anomalies, inconsistencies, and potential data quality issues that include those that could impact AI model performance
  • Application of AI technologies to Data Quality Management

Data Quality Rule Definition and Implementation:

  • Work closely with business stakeholders and AI/ML teams to define, refine, and validate data quality rules, ensuring they align with business requirements and the specific needs of GenAI and Agentic AI models
  • Ensure adherence to Deloitte's data governance policies and standards, contributing to a robust framework that supports ethical, responsible, and compliant AI development

Issue Identification and Resolution:

  • Proactively identify, analyse, and document data quality issues, performing root cause analysis and collaborating with data owners and technical teams to implement effective remediation strategies

Data Cleansing and Transformation:

  • Support data cleansing initiatives, correcting or excluding inaccurate, incomplete, or irrelevant data to maintain error-free datasets
  • Data Quality Monitoring and Reporting:
  • Develop and implement continuous data quality monitoring processes, establishing key metrics and creating dashboards to track data accuracy, integrity, and fitness for purpose
  • Maintain thorough documentation of data quality processes, rules, issues, and resolutions, particularly as they pertain to AI data pipelines

AI Data Readiness:

  • Specifically focus on preparing data for GenAI and Agentic AI initiatives, ensuring data is structured, transformed, contextualised, and accessible. This includes detecting and mitigating biases in AI data, managing unstructured data for Large Language Models (LLMs), and ensuring data lineage is clear for explainable AI

Collaboration and Communication:

  • Collaborate cross-functionally with Data Engineers, Data Scientists, AI Developers, and business users to embed data quality best practices throughout the data lifecycle and provide continuous feedback on data requirements for advanced AI

Connect to your skills and professional experience

Essentials:

  • Proven experience in data quality management, data governance, or a related data management discipline
  • Deep understanding of data quality dimensions (e.g., accuracy, completeness, consistency, timeliness, validity, uniqueness)
  • Proficiency with data profiling, data cleansing, and data standardisation techniques and tools (e.g., Informatica Data Quality, Talend Data Quality, Collibra, Ataccama, or similar)
  • Strong analytical and problem-solving skills, with the ability to identify root causes and propose practical solutions for complex data issues
  • Understanding of how data quality impacts AI model performance, reliability, and the mitigation of issues like hallucinations
  • Excellent communication, presentation, and people skills, with the ability to influence and collaborate effectively with technical and non-technical stakeholders
  • Ability to work independently and manage multiple priorities in a challenging environment

Desirable Skills:

  • Experience in the professional services
  • Familiarity with cloud data platforms (e.g., AWS, Azure, GCP) and their data quality capabilities
  • Knowledge of Master Data Management (MDM) and Metadata Management concepts
  • Experience with data quality tools specifically designed for unstructured data or text analytics
  • Relevant industry certifications e.g., DAMA Certified Data Management Professional (CDMP), Data Quality certifications)
  • Bachelors or masters degree (or equivalent qualification) in Computer Science, Information Systems, Data Science, or a related quantitative field.

Personal independence

Regulation and controls are standard practice in our industry and Deloitte is no exception. These controls provide important legal protection for both you and the firm. We are subject to a number of audit regulations, one of which requires that certain colleagues abide by specific personal independence constraints (e.g., in relation to any financial interests and employment relationships). This can mean that you and your "Immediate Family Members" are not permitted to hold certain financial interests (shares, funds, bonds etc.) with audit clients of the firm, and also prohibitions on certain employment relationships (e.g., you are not permitted to hold a secondary employment role with SEC audit clients of the firm whilst being employed by the firm). The recruitment team will provide further details as you progress through the recruitment process, or you can contact the Independence team upon request.
